While Pembroke Dock train station doesn't have a staffed ticket office, it compensates with modern ticket machines, allowing for quick ticket collections and purchases using major credit or debit cards. For those requiring assistance, staff are reachable via a helpline, ensuring travelers feel confident throughout their journey. A thoughtful nod to accessibility, the station boasts step-free access from its car park to the platform, making it comfortable for travelers with mobility needs. Unfortunately, facilities like waiting rooms, restrooms, and lounges are not available, making the station a quick in and out pit stop for travelers.
Finding your way to a new destination from Pembroke Dock is quite straightforward. Although the station itself lacks bicycle hire facilities and local taxis or car rental services, alternatives like the rail replacement bus ensure smooth transitions. The bus stop is conveniently located at the rear of the station, allowing for easy planning when rail services are disrupted.

While Brundall Gardens may not boast a wide array of amenities, it functions as a cozy spot for travelers to begin their journeys. The station doesn't have a ticket office, ticket machines, or smartcard issuance, which means you'd need to plan ahead and purchase your tickets online or through mobile apps. An induction loop is available for hearing-aid users, ensuring that everyone can access information easily.
The station provides step-free access to Platform 2, facilitating a seamless boarding experience if you're heading towards Great Yarmouth and Lowestoft. However, bear in mind that access to Platform 1 requires navigating a footbridge. It’s essential to plan accordingly to avoid any inconvenience, especially if you have mobility concerns.
Brundall Gardens station focuses on offering essential support to its passengers. A help point is available for any assistance you may require, and customer service is reachable by phone to address any queries. The station does not feature facilities like toilets, refreshment outlets, or waiting rooms, so planning your trip with these limitations in mind is advisable.
Transport linkages remain an essential aspect of the station's connectivity. Though car parking and bike hire are not provided, there are five cycle stands available on Platform 2, promoting an eco-friendly travel approach. Additionally, rail replacement bus services operate from a nearby bus stop on Cucumber Lane should your travel plans encounter any interruptions.
